Overview
The Resato Argo 1530 is a versatile CNC waterjet cutting system designed for industrial production of medium-format workpieces. Built around Resato's high-pressure intensifier pump technology, the Argo delivers consistent 4,000 bar (58,000 PSI) cutting pressure with a compact bridge-type cutting head structure. The 1500x3000mm work area covers a broad range of sheet materials including stainless steel, titanium, aluminum, glass, stone, and composites. The ABB servo-driven gantry provides smooth 5-axis motion for complex contour cutting and bevel work. Resato's SmartPump technology with variable speed drive reduces energy consumption by up to 40% compared to fixed-speed intensifiers. The Argo integrates with Resato's ARCam cutting software for part nesting, tool path simulation, and production management. Typical customers include aerospace subcontractors, automotive stamping die shops, and architectural fabricators.
Full Specifications
| Parameter | Value |
|---|---|
| Work Area | 1500 x 3000 mm (59 x 118 in) |
| Pump Pressure | 4,000 bar (58,000 PSI) |
| Pump Power | 22 kW (30 HP) |
| Cutting Head | 5-axis tilting head |
| Positioning Speed | Up to 30 m/min |
| Linear Accuracy | ±0.05 mm |
| Abrasive Flow Rate | 0.1-0.9 kg/min |
| Control System | ARCam / Siemens-based |
| Machine Weight | ~4,200 kg |
Strengths & Limitations
Strengths
- SmartPump VFD technology for energy savings up to 40%
- 5-axis head standard for bevel and taper-free cutting
- Modular pump architecture for easy capacity scaling
- ABB servo drives for high dynamic performance
- Compact footprint for the 1.5x3m work envelope
Limitations
- Resato dealer network smaller than OMAX/Flow in North America
- ARCam software has steeper learning curve vs. IntelliCAM
- Mid-range pressure (58K PSI) vs. top-tier 90K PSI systems

SmartPump uses a variable frequency drive on the pump motor to match output pressure and flow to actual cutting demand rather than running full throttle constantly. This reduces energy consumption by 30-40% compared to fixed-speed intensifier pumps.
